Flat roof vent installation services involve the placement of ventilation systems on flat or low-slope roofs to promote proper airflow and air exchange within a building. These services typically include assessing the roof’s structure, selecting appropriate vent types, and securely installing the vents to ensure they function effectively over time. Proper installation is crucial to prevent leaks, water intrusion, and damage caused by improper sealing or placement. Experienced service providers focus on integrating the vents seamlessly into the roof design, maintaining the roof’s integrity while improving its ventilation capabilities.
One of the primary problems addressed by flat roof vent installation is excess heat and moisture buildup inside the building. Without adequate ventilation, heat can accumulate, leading to increased cooling costs and reduced energy efficiency. Moisture accumulation can cause iss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and deterioration of roofing materials. Installing vents helps to alleviate these problems by allowing hot air and moisture to escape, maintaining a healthier indoor environment and extending the lifespan of the roof and structure.

Professional flat roof vent installation involves selecting the right type of vents for the specific property and roof design. Common options include static vents, turbine vents, and powered exhaust fans, each suited to different needs and roof configurations. Skilled contractors ensure that vents are properly sealed and integrated into the roofing system,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age. Why are roof vents important for flat roofs? Roof vents help regulate airflow, prevent moisture buildup, and reduce heat accumulation, which can extend the lifespan of a flat roof.
What types of roof vents are suitable for flat roofs? Common options include static vents, turbine vents, and powered vents, each designed to improve ventilation based on specific needs.
How long does the installation of flat roof vents typically take? Installation duration varies depending on the project scope, but it gener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
Can roof vents be installed on existing flat roofs? Yes, many local contractors offer vent installation services for existing flat roofs to enhance ventilation and airflow.
What should be considered when choosing roof vents for a flat roof? Factors include the roof’s size, ventilation needs, local climate, and compatibility with the roof’s structure.
